Mageia 5 - So Much Better Than Last Time

The Mageia Control Centre is a good tool for managing your software installations, your hardware and internet connections.
There haven't been any crashes since I started using Mageia. The only real issue I had was the lack of sound whilst watching MP4 videos which I can't give an answer to because it suddenly started working again. (Cue the people saying "you had the volume turned down, didn't you?".
So with everything that has been written can I now recommend Mageia to the readers of this blog? Absolutely.
